If you really want to get a tv I would highly suggest doing a little bit of research on the model you're after, I'd recommend going over to CNET.com for reviews. I got a Samsung Series 6 LCD after a few hours of research. I liked the fact that I could plug in a hard drive, computer, or plug it into the network to watch videos I download off the internet. It also got high marks on it's overall picture quality.
When getting an LED or LCD one of the most important features will be the refresh rate called Hertz or on paper Hz. You want AT LEAST a 100hz tv and preferably a 200hz tv. 50hz on a LCD or LED will look very choppy. Hope this helps...
